What Accident & Hospital Indemnity Insurance Typically Covers

Accident and hospital indemnity insurance provide cash benefits when unexpected injuries or hospital stays disrupt your finances. These plans are designed to supplement your health coverage and help manage out-of-pocket expenses.

Accident Insurance

Pays cash benefits for covered injuries such as broken bones, sprains, emergency room visits, stitches, ambulance rides, and more. Benefits are paid directly to you, regardless of what your health insurance covers.

Hospital Indemnity Insurance

Pays a daily, weekly, or lump-sum benefit for each day you’re hospitalized due to illness or injury. This helps offset costs like deductibles, copays, and non-medical expenses during recovery.

Flexible Benefits

Gives you complete control over how your payout is used. Funds can cover medical bills, travel, rent, groceries, or lost income while you focus on healing.

Standalone or Supplemental

Works with any health insurance plan, Medicare, or employer-provided coverage. No coordination is required, so benefits are paid even if another policy already covers the claim.

Common Questions About Accident & Hospital Indemnity Insurance

  • Is this a replacement for health insurance?

    No—these plans pay cash directly to you, not medical providers.

  • What types of accidents are covered?

    Most policies cover everyday accidents: slips, falls, sports injuries, car accidents, and more.

  • How quickly do I get paid after a claim?

    Usually within days of submitting required documentation.

  • Do I need hospital indemnity with Medicare Advantage?

    Many choose it to help cover copays and daily hospital costs—ask us for advice.
